English Translation
Affan narrated to us, Hammad, meaning Ibn Salamah, narrated to us, he said: Thabit informed us, from Anas that Harithah ibn al-Rubayyi' came to [the battle of] Badr as a spectator, and he was a young boy. A stray arrow came and struck the hollow of his throat, killing him. His mother came to the Prophet ﷺ and said: 'O Messenger of Allah, you know the place of Harithah in my heart. If he is in Paradise, I will be patient. If not, you will see what I do.' He ﷺ said: "O Umm Harithah, there are many gardens in Paradise, and your son has attained al-Firdaws al-A'la."
